Ever since I was a child, animals have been a massive part of my life and my family. Especially horses. Every waking moment was to be spent in their presence, and if that wasn't possible I would pretend I was one... Often ruining my mother's garden pottery in the search of suitable show jumps so me in my sister could "do some schooling". 

​

As the years have drawn on, I have had the fortunate pleasure of bringing on and working with many of my own horses. However, one opposing view I have faced in this culture was working resistant horses without consideration for pain. Often times one was expected to "ride through" a frequently occurring situation were a horse was sticking up or resistant to perform an action on multiple occasions. In the back of my head, these methods bothered me...

​

My work with horses continued after-hours when I got a job working for an SPCA. Some days were hard, saying goodbye to a life was always difficult, no matter how recently acquainted. Staff and volunteers here helped as best an possible on a minimal budget but often these animals came in with disabilities that prevented or limited their adoption potential.   

​

Spurred into a direction to better understand the inner workings of animals and how to help them, I found my passion in veterinary physiotherapy. After graduating a 4 year BSc course in veterinary physiotherapy in 2021 from Equine Librium College, I started Joint Ventures Veterinary Physiotherapy.
 

The How

Now you've heard my "Why", I'm going to give you the "How".

Through my physiotherapy treatments, I intend to offer an integrated approach to animal wellness that focuses on rehabilitation and prevention of dysfunction. By adhering to this philosophy, I hope to prevent pain, boost performance and enhance longevity for the furry person in your life.
